COLOMBO (News 1st); A sweeping investigation into organized crime has begun to unravel what could be one of the most explosive political scandals in recent memory.
Cabinet Spokesman Minister Dr. Nalinda Jayatissa has confirmed that political connections to criminal gangs are being systematically exposed.
Speaking at a media briefing, Dr. Jayatissa emphasized the gravity of the situation, stating that the investigation is being conducted with precision and without panic.
“This is not a routine operation. It’s not a game. The criminal network has extended across a significant area, and the investigation is revealing links to certain security agencies and political mechanisms,” he said.
Questions have emerged regarding the possible involvement of high-ranking police officers, particularly in the Southern Province.
A journalist pointed out the rapid rise of a former police media spokesman, who was promoted from Superintendent of Police (SP) to Senior DIG within just four years.
In response, Minister Jayatissa acknowledged that the investigation has already led to the arrest of individuals connected to various state institutions.
“Based on those taken into custody and the manner in which some are being interrogated under Detention Orders, it’s clear that individuals linked to the police, prison system, and other government services are being apprehended. The law applies equally to everyone—whether they are in the police, intelligence services, or prison administration,” he said.
